Yeah, I drove a stick WRX last month

Took it for a 1/2 hour test drive with my dad. As soon as we left the dealership my dad pulled over and told me to take it out for the whole time. That is a fun car! I totally agree with mzmtg that is is a dog below 3500 rpm, but once you rev it hold on! If you get this car in auto, u are just damn lazy because u could never tap its full power potential. And the handling is superb!

I agree with hlh0501 that the last gen sub looked a lot better, but I love the way the hood bulges in front of you when you're behind the wheel.

Overall it is a great car, but I wouldn't compare it to a maxima because they are not even close to the same car - maxima has room, luxury, low-end torque, FWD, ok handling (needs mods) and the WRX is small, sporty interior with seats that have great lateral support, high-end hp, AWD, and amazing handling.
